Practical Designer Notes Before You Launch
Before dropping Painted Cowgirls Tumbler Wrap 20oz into client work or paid campaigns, run these quick checks:
- Test it against your brand’s primary and secondary color palette—does it harmonize or clash in flat and gradient applications?
- Convert to grayscale—does the contrast hold? Is silhouette readability preserved for black-and-white uses like packaging stamps or embroidery guides?
- Place it inside real tumbler mockups (not just white backgrounds)—observe how lighting and curvature affect perception.
- Preview on mobile screens at 50% size—verify legibility of key features (hat brim, hair flow, boot detail).
- Compare side-by-side with top 3 competitor visuals—does it differentiate or blend in?
- Pair with your brand fonts: Does it complement serif elegance, sans-serif clarity, script intimacy, or display-bold impact?
- Review spacing—does it breathe well next to headlines, CTAs, or logos—or does it crowd the layout?
- Confirm commercial license terms—this is essential for digital sellers, agencies, and creators monetizing Canva templates or social media graphics.
